Fifty years ago, I stood alongside my friend, Congressman Henry Hyde, as we worked tirelessly to draft and pass the Hyde Amendment. We didn't do it for political theater; we did it to ensure that your conscience—and your wallet—would never be forced into a partnership with death.
The Hyde Amendment prohibits the use of your tax dollars to fund abortion. It has been renewed in budget negotiations every year since 1977. While the final version included exceptions that ALL has never supported, the original intent and purpose is to not allow taxpayer-funded abortion.
